For my own experience of moving too many times to count in the past 10 years, many apartment buildings will want you to sign a lease. Some will give you the option of a lease or renting month-to-month, but you risk rent increases without a lease.

 

As for when you should start looking, I would recommend trying to find something starting in July to rent for August 1. Others will tell you different, that you will have no trouble finding a place in August. It's up to you, but I personally wouldn't risk waiting until the rush of post-secondary students looking for places in August. You may end up with something less desirable or downright miserable. There are reasons why some places near the hospital/university fill up sooner than others :)

 

Of course you will probably have less trouble finding a place to rent later if you are loooking at areas beyond the hospital vicinity. Of which there are many nice and cheaper neighbourhoods within reasonable distance.
